Let D be the conic domain {(x, t) ∈Rn+1 : |x|g(x/|x|) < t < +∞} lying in the half-space t > 0, and bounded by the conic manifold S= {(x, t) ∈Rn+1 : t = |x|g(x/|x|)}, where g is an entirely definite, positive, continuous, piecewise smooth function given on the unit sphere of the space Rn. For τ > 0, by Dτ := {(x, t) ∈Rn+1 : |x|g(x/|x|) < t < τ} we denote the domain lying in the half-space t > 0, bounded by the cone S and the hyperplane t = τ.
